Discovering Steamboat Resort

1. Steamboat: Where Western Heritage Meets World-Class Skiing

Steamboat Resort, often simply referred to as "Steamboat," is located in the charming town of Steamboat Springs, Colorado. It is renowned for its friendly atmosphere and genuine Western hospitality. The town itself exudes a unique blend of Old West and modern resort amenities.

2. Planning Your Steamboat Getaway

Before you hit the slopes, thorough planning is key to a memorable trip. Here are some essential considerations:

a. Accommodations

Steamboat offers a wide array of lodging options, from cozy cabins to luxurious slopeside condos. Consider staying at The Steamboat Grand, Sheraton Steamboat Resort Villas, or Trappeur's Crossing Resort & Spa for a comfortable stay.

b. Lift Tickets and Passes

To maximize your time on the mountain, purchase lift tickets or passes in advance. Steamboat offers various options, including daily lift tickets, multi-day passes, and season passes.

c. Equipment Rentals

If you don't have your gear, fear not. Steamboat has numerous rental shops where you can find high-quality skis, snowboards, and equipment. Some shops even offer delivery services to your accommodation.

d. Lessons and Guided Adventures

Steamboat provides excellent opportunities for skiers and snowboarders of all levels to improve their skills. Enroll in group or private lessons to make the most of your time on the mountain.

Conquering the Legendary Slopes

3. Steamboat's Champagne Powder® Snow

Steamboat is world-famous for its Champagne Powder®, a term coined for its exceptionally dry and light snow. Here are some must-visit areas:

a. Storm Peak

For intermediate and advanced skiers looking for diverse terrain and stunning views, Storm Peak offers a range of challenging runs and glades.

b. Sunshine Bowl

Sunshine Bowl is perfect for intermediate skiers and families, with well-groomed slopes and beautiful Colorado vistas.

c. Pioneer Ridge

For expert skiers seeking steep and challenging terrain, Pioneer Ridge offers exhilarating runs and deep powder stashes.

4. Après-Ski Delights

After an exciting day on the slopes, indulge in some après-ski activities:

a. Dining

Steamboat boasts a vibrant culinary scene. Enjoy a hearty steak at the Ore House at the Pine Grove, savor international flavors at Laundry Kitchen & Cocktails, or go for a cozy meal at Mambo Italiano.

b. Shopping

Explore the charming downtown area of Steamboat Springs for boutique shopping, art galleries, and unique souvenirs. Western wear and outdoor gear are abundant.

c. Relaxation

Unwind at one of Steamboat's rejuvenating spas. A massage or soak in a hot tub will prepare you for another day of skiing.
